Derek Brown (running back)

Derek Dernell Brown (born April 15, 1971 in Banning, California) is a former American football running back. Brown played for four seasons in the National Football League for the New Orleans Saints. He started his career at Servite High School in Anaheim, California, and graduated in 1993 from the University of Nebraska. While at Servite High, a school with other notable football alumni such as Steve Beuerlein, Turk Schonert, and Blaine Nye, he set the Orange County single season rushing record with a mark of over 3,000 yards .
